Police have arrested seven people over the chaos that erupted outside the PCEA Church in Kariobangi North on Sunday, November 30, during a service attended by former Deputy President Rigathi Gachagua. The National Police Service (NPS) has firmly rejected claims that officers threw teargas inside PCEA Kariobangi North on Sunday, November 30, during a church service attended by former Deputy President Rigathi Gachagua. Former Deputy President Rigathi Gachagua now claims President William Ruto’s administration used goons and armed police to influence voting in Malava and Mbeere-North constituencies. The National Police Service has cautioned political leaders against disrupting Thursday’s by-elections, following fresh claims of possible state interference from several politicians, including DCP party leader Rigathi Gachagua. Former Deputy President Rigathi Gachagua has accused IEBC Vice Chairperson Fahima Araphat Abdalla of attempting to influence the upcoming Magarini by-election scheduled for November 27. Former Deputy President Rigathi Gachagua has made startling allegations, claiming that President William Ruto orchestrated a plot to assassinate him. At his Karen residence on Monday, May 19, 2025, Gachagua asserted that state-sponsored officers had explicit instructions to eliminate him. This is during a church service in Gatanga, Murang’a County, on Sunday, May 18.
